The first part of the special project “Subordination of the territory: as the Soviet Union and its heiress Russia treat resources, people and nature.” Back in Soviet times, Russia was densely “hooked” on the “oil needle”. Nefedollars plugged holes in a socialist planned economy. By the mid-1970s, the USSR accounted for 20 % of all oil produced, it ranked first in the world. Almost 60 % of the country's oil was produced in the Khanty-Mansiysk Autonomous Okrug (Khanty-Mansi Autonomous Okrug).
